Summary
One of a pair of Kangxi biscuit figures of donkeys, made in China about 1700-20. Saddled and harnessed, with 'egg-and-spinach' decoration. Colours, green, yellow and aubergine.
Provenance
The bequest of Margaret (Anderson) McEwan, The Hon. Mrs Ronald - later Dame Margaret - Henry Fulke Greville, DBE (1863-1942) from probate records linked with the donation of the property to the National Trust in 1943. This item found on the record for Polesden Lacey Chinese Porcelain stored in the basement, page 91.
